Yes, it's possible to pursue a double master's degree in English and Business at Yale University, but it would typically require applying separately to each program and meeting the specific admission requirements for both the English and Business schools at Yale. Yale University offers a range of graduate programs in both disciplines, including Master of Arts (MA) in English and Master of Business Administration (MBA) degrees.
Applying for a double master's program would likely involve demonstrating strong academic credentials, relevant work experience, and a clear rationale for pursuing both degrees concurrently. You may need to submit separate applications to each program and fulfill the admission requirements for each, including standardized test scores (such as GRE or GMAT), letters of recommendation, essays, and interviews.
